Church Dedicates Bench for Veterans

On Saturday, September 3, members of the Thrivent Community at Redeemer Lutheran Church in Vineland donated a large bench for residents of the Vineland Memorial Soldier’s Home. It was placed to look out over the cemetery. Home Depot installed the pad for the bench.

The day also commemorated the signing of the peace agreement with Japan in 1945 (VJ Day) and the date that the American Flag was first flown in battle, in 1777.

The bench was purchased with the proceeds from the church’s Annual Strawberry Festival and through donations from the membership.
